π Key Responsibilities
β
Collaborate with affiliate partners, e-commerce platforms, and other media partners to acquire quality users efficiently.
β
Manage end-to-end campaign execution, including audience segmentation, creative testing, bidding, and budget pacing.
β
Analyze campaign performance and generate actionable insights to drive performance improvements.
β
Own daily, weekly, and monthly performance metrics including CPI/CAC, CTR.
β
Stay updated with the latest performance marketing trends and platform updates.
